MySQL企业版与社区版主要区别在于功能、支持和成本。企业版提供高级功能、更全面的备份和恢复、高级安全特性,以及专业的客户支持。社区版则完全免费,但功能有限,支持由社区提供。选择时需根据具体需求、预算和对支持的需求来决定。
本文目录导读:
随着互联网技术的飞速发展,MySQL作为一款开源数据库,已经成为全球范围内最受欢迎的数据库之一,MySQL官方提供了企业版和社区版两个版本,这让许多企业在选择时感到困惑,本文将深入解析MySQL企业版与社区版的区别,帮助您做出明智的选择。
图片来源于网络,如有侵权联系删除
版权和授权
1、社区版
MySQL社区版(MySQL Community Server)是完全开源的,用户可以免费下载、使用、修改和分发,它遵循GNU通用公共许可证(GPL),这意味着用户在使用过程中,需要遵守相关条款。
2、企业版
MySQL企业版(MySQL Enterprise)是MySQL官方推出的商业版本,它提供了额外的功能和支持服务,企业版遵循MySQL许可协议,用户在购买后可以获得相应的使用权。
功能差异
1、性能优化
(1)社区版
社区版提供了基本的性能优化功能,如索引、查询缓存、分区等,在面对大规模、高并发的场景时,社区版的性能可能无法满足需求。
(2)企业版
企业版在性能优化方面提供了更多高级功能,如性能监控、自动性能优化、分区优化等,企业版还支持集群、高可用性、分布式数据库等功能,以确保在复杂业务场景下的稳定运行。
2、安全性
(1)社区版
社区版在安全性方面提供了一定的保障,如用户权限、数据加密等,由于开源特性,社区版可能存在安全漏洞。
图片来源于网络,如有侵权联系删除
(2)企业版
企业版在安全性方面提供了更多高级功能,如安全审计、数据加密、访问控制等,企业版还定期进行安全更新,确保系统安全。
3、高可用性
(1)社区版
社区版提供了一定程度的高可用性支持,如主从复制、故障转移等。
(2)企业版
企业版在高可用性方面提供了更多高级功能,如集群、高可用性组、故障转移等,这些功能可以帮助企业在面对硬件故障、网络问题等场景时,确保业务连续性。
4、技术支持
(1)社区版
社区版用户可以访问MySQL官方论坛、社区等渠道获取技术支持。
(2)企业版
企业版用户可以享受MySQL官方提供的技术支持服务,包括电话、邮件、远程协助等,企业版还提供专业的培训、咨询等服务。
图片来源于网络,如有侵权联系删除
选择指南
1、项目规模
对于小型项目或个人开发者,社区版足以满足需求,而对于大型企业或高并发场景,企业版更具优势。
2、安全性要求
如果项目对安全性要求较高,建议选择企业版。
3、技术支持需求
如果需要专业的技术支持,企业版是更好的选择。
4、预算
企业版需要付费购买,而社区版免费,根据企业预算,选择合适的版本。
MySQL企业版与社区版在功能、性能、安全性等方面存在较大差异,企业在选择时,应根据项目规模、安全性要求、技术支持需求以及预算等因素综合考虑,希望本文对您有所帮助。
标签: #功能差异解析
评论列表